Inclusion criteria
Inclusion criteria: Married females of Age group 20 to 40 years having leucorrhoea due to non-infective cervical lesions e.g. cervical erosion, chronic cervicitis, mucous polyps, increased pelvic congestion e.g. uterine prolapsed, acquired retroverted uterus, chronic pelvic inflammation Controlled diabetes
Exclusion criteria
Exclusion criteria: i. Pregnant or lactating women ii. Patients on Oral Contraceptive Pills iii. Patients with IUCD iv. Patients with physiological leucorrhoea (e.g. during ovulation, pre-menstrual, pregnancy) v. Patients with abnormal (excessive) vaginal discharge due to neoplasmic changes vi. Positive history of venereal diseases vii. Patients suffering from uncontrolled diabetes viii. Patients with Anemia (Hb% below 7)
